HSBC appoints Alan Turner as head of commercial banking for Singapore

In this role, Mr Turner will have responsibility for HSBC’s Large Corporates and Small and Medium Enterprise (SME) banking segments, as well as leading the Global Trade and Receivables Finance, and Global Liquidity and Cash Management solutions businesses in Singapore.
